Description
Chickpea stands out for being a remarkable source of slow-absorbing carbohydrates, which produce a gradual assimilation of glucose, thus avoiding the imbalance of sugar levels and generating constant energy.
Indication
It is very protein, but at the same time, very low in saturated fat and rich in fiber. By combining chickpeas with cereals (rice, couscous) the quality of their proteins increases. Thus, its richness in fiber improves intestinal transit and helps the absorption of carbohydrates to be even slower. Chickpea is rich in minerals, especially phosphorous, iron, and magnesium, and is especially rich in vitamins B1, B6, and folic acid.
Intake mode
It is recommended to include both hot and cold dishes. It offers many possibilities in the kitchen, it allows the preparation of very diverse and consistent dishes, from winter stews and stews to summer salads.
Precautions
May contain traces of gluten, soy, nuts, sesame, milk, celery and mustard.
Ingredients
Chickpeas *, water, salt.
(*) from organic farming.
